Casa Solaris Off the Coast of Puerto Rico

Architect John Hix—who worked under renowned American architect and concrete aficionado Louis Kahn—went as green as possible to preserve this natural enclave when he designed the hotel Hix Island House in Vieques—off the coast of Puerto Rico. The most recent guest house on the property, it's completely removed from the commercial grid and runs solely on solar power.

Casa Comunal in Panama

Situated on the idyllic Caribbean shoreline of Isla Colon—the largest and northernmost island in the Bocas del Toro archipelago in Panama—Casa Comunal is a new Caribbean getaway that embeds travelers in the local culture and promotes a cooperative mindset. The modern vacation house enjoys a private beachfront with ample access to the outdoors. 

The open plan compound consists of Casa Norte and Casa Sur, two units that share an atrium entryway with large doors that roll open or closed to join or connect the two spaces. Much of the shape of Casa Comunal derives from the existing flora on the site, which includes many fruit-bearing trees.

Casa Kimball in the Dominican Republic

A luxury beachfront property in the Dominican Republic, the 20,000-square-foot, ultra-modern Casa Kimball sits on three acres of land facing the Atlantic Ocean. The villa centers around a 156-foot infinity pool that extends straight out towards a cliff—and seamlessly blends indoor and outdoor living.

Treetop House in Malpais, Costa Rica

Nestled in the treetops of Malpais, Costa Rica, and designed by Costa Rican architect Benjamin Garcia Saxe, this beautiful home has been shortlisted for "House of the Year" by World Architecture News and awarded five Costa Rican Biennial awards.  

The interconnecting teak-and-bamboo, pod-like design floats above the trees with 180-degree views of the mountains and the Pacific.
